The document, acquired by a well-placed US source, threatens to undermine US President Barack Obama's claim last week that all Americans were "surprised, disappointed and angry" to learn of Megrahi's release.

The note added: "Nevertheless, if Scottish authorities come to the conclusion that Megrahi must be released from Scottish custody, the US position is that conditional release on compassionate grounds would be a far preferable alternative to prisoner transfer, which we strongly oppose."

But then there were these statements coming out of the Obama Adminstration in August 2009

"It's the policy of this administration as enunciated ... by Secretary of State [Hillary] Clinton, that this individual should serve out his term where he's serving it right now," said White House spokesman Robert Gibbs.
